Healthful Behavior

Healthful practices that needs to be established when they are young include the following:

? Brushing teeth twice every day, at a minimum - Brushing your tongue to remove bacteria, utilizing a tongue cleaner - Flossing one or more times every day - Avoiding refined sugars, and - Decreasing acidic meals.

In infants, unique care need to be taken to make certain correct tooth and gum health, long just before they cut their initial tooth. After every meal or bottle feeding, parents ought to rinse infant gums with a wet towel. Bottles ought to not be kept in a bed to ensure that the mouth can go prolonged periods of time without exposure. Soft brushes and finger caps may be purchased, along with fluoride-free toothpastes designed for infants. These needs to be used to clean the initial teeth that start to appear. Scrubbing of infant teeth needs to be done twice each day, at minimum.

Once a child has cut what may seem to be a full group of teeth, they ought to visit a Louisville pediatric dentist. In addition to these every day habits, children ought to visit a dental professional twice per year for a routine check-up and full x-rays. The cleanings can help remove any plaque build-up and restore gum health.
